How to find the minimal possible sum of two distinct elements in an array with JavaScript

/*
    Goal:
    -----
    Find the minimal value of (a[i] + a[j]) for any two distinct elements in an array.

    Efficient Strategy (O(n)):
    --------------------------
    The smallest possible sum of two distinct elements is obtained by:
        - finding the smallest element
        - finding the second smallest element
    Because any other pair must be >= one of these two.

    We scan the array once, keeping track of:
        - min1  = smallest element seen so far
        - min2  = second smallest element seen so far
*/

// A function that computes the minimal sum of two distinct elements.
function minimal_two_sum(arr) {
    // Handle edge case: need at least two elements
    if (arr.length < 2) {
        throw new Error("Array must contain at least two elements.");
    }

    // Initialize min1 and min2 to very large values
    let min1 = Infinity;
    let min2 = Infinity;

    // Single pass through the array
    for (const x of arr) {
        if (x < min1) {
            // x becomes the new smallest; old min1 becomes min2
            min2 = min1;
            min1 = x;
        } else if (x < min2) {
            // x is not the smallest, but smaller than the second smallest
            min2 = x;
        }
    }

    // The minimal sum of two distinct elements
    return min1 + min2;
}

const arr = [7, -3, 10, 1, 5, 2, 4];

try {
    const result = minimal_two_sum(arr);
    console.log("Minimal sum of two elements:", result);
} catch (e) {
    console.error("Error:", e.message);
}



/*
run:

Minimal sum of two elements: -2

*/
